the tune is what is programmed onto the ECU to make your car run with certain values, like for example advancing spark timing. a tune probably wont fix your issue. i'm guessing that if the donor cars ECU is plugged in, and that the PATS module is also from the donor car, its either a wiring issue, or something might have failed. but i'm no expert on the stock computer by any means.
how exactly did you perform the swap?
i'm assuming that you swapped both the column and the ECU from the donor car. if you didnt swap the ECU over, as stated they are matched pairs. its like swapping locks to the front door of your house, you cant expect to swap the lock, and have your old key still work...
